Extend the Power of Scientific Computing with Cloud and AI

The Department of Energy National Laboratory community is focused on continuously expanding the boundaries of science and physics. And scientific computing fuels this work. High Performance computing (HPC), AI, advanced data analytics, and cloud computing are essential technologies in the quest to work smarter and innovate faster. This technical seminar explored how Google Cloud can complement the National Laboratory community’s vast on-premises IT infrastructure environments and support efforts to combine the power of AI, machine learning, and more traditional simulation and modeling technologies to accelerate time to discovery and innovation.

Specifically, this seminar:

  • Presented use cases tailored to the DOE science community
  • Examined how Google Cloud can complement DOE HPC facilities, accelerating scientific discovery
  • Explored the potential of Google Cloud AI to complement traditional sim/mod in HPC
  • Provided a deep dive into Google Cloud security solutions and how we leverage big data analytics to protect our customers from cyber threats
